I think it changed over the years, but here's what I think is correct generally.

GS - base spec. XS - add half-leather seating, roof rails, cruise control, stereo controls on steering wheel, twin manual sunroofs, climate control ES - add heated front screen, heated seats, full leather, electric sunroofs

7-seaters available in all trim levels, all 7-seaters and all XS & ES models have rear self-levelling air suspension.

Many other variations on a theme, such as the "landmark" you mention, not sure at all what they were based on but I wouldn't expect a special to have less than XS trim level. When it came to the end of the Disco 2 line, Landrover reduced the trim levels down to just three. 'Landmark' is the middle one, 'Premium' was the top, the bottom one I think begain with 'S', can't remember the actually word.

The Landmark came well equiped, the Premium was only better spec'd by having sat nav, the more speaker Harmon Kardon ICE and active cornering enhancement (ACE) as standard and possibly heated seats.
